WebFor low-cut shoes, create extra loops using of the top eyelets and lace through these to tighten the heel in place. For high-ankle boots, use a surgeon’s knot directly opposite the heel to lock the heel in place. Then tie off higher up the boot using the metal eyelets. Web20 mrt. 2024 · Method #2 – The Sasquatch. If you have extremely wide and large feet, this is the method for you. You will lace them exactly the same as the old school, starting at the bottom eyelets. The difference here is you will skip the next set of eyelets, giving you more room in the shoes for your larger feet. You will still need to tie them as tight ... Web20 apr. 2024 · This is the case with Knot Theory, for which Kelvin’s friend and fellow scientist Peter Guthrie Tait did much of the pioneering work. He created a systematic classification of common knots with 10 or fewer crossings. The Unknot, top left, was thought to represent hydrogen. The knot immediately to its right was considered to be carbon.
